UCL: Guardiola confirms Man City injury blow ahead Real Madrid clash

Manchester City manager, Pep Guardiola, has said he substituted Josko Gvardiol at half time of their 4-2 win at Crystal Palace, because the player picked up a knock.
Gvardiol started the game at Selhurst Park, but was replaced by Manuel Akanji at the break.
The Croatian defender is now an injury doubt for their Champions League trip to Real Madrid next Tuesday.

“We will see which players we have available because Josko [Gvardiol] had a little problem. We will see. Next one.
“We were unlucky to play early on after Aston Villa but now lucky we have time to recover before Real Madrid. We will try to give them a good game,” Guardiola said afterwards.
